Nezahuacoyotl wrote:
And another issue: i want to build a house by the side of another one i already built. I already left a 7x7 paved space and already checked, it is all paved. and there's nothing on the way. (i can't hide the tree with my Ender's client. it keeps showing, but I checked and no sillhouette is highlighted behind the tree)

Is there a restriction for building houses too close one to another, or tiles need to be clear in a 1 square offset, or certainly there's something behind the tree and I didn't remove it?

(i don't want to remove the tree, I like it there :3
and if I seccessfully paved that tile and achieved a 7x7 square, the tree shouldn't be a problem there, should it?)


i guess the fence might be the problem - try with destroying it, build house, rebuild fence ?!?

Re: Please Ask Simple Questions Here

Postby GrapefruitV » Sat Jul 12, 2014 2:50 pm

kejtk wrote:I bought Lawspeaking skill, but I still don't have access to Village Claim, don't have option to build it. Why?

You need to "discover" bones, dreams, stones, bear teeth and deer antlers with that char.
